Maven多模块项目,适用于一些比较大的项目,通过合理的模块拆分,实现代码的复用,便于维护和管理。尤其是一些开源框架,也是采用多模块的方式,提供插件集成,用户可以根据需要配置指定的模块。 Maven多模块(pom) 1.…
分类:maven
Maven 教程
1. 介绍 构建(build)一个项目包括:下载依赖,编译源代码,执行单元测试,以及打包编译后的源代码等一系列子任务。手工的执行这些任务是一项非常繁琐,且容易出错的事情。Maven封装了这些子任务,并提供给用户执行这些子…
maven
Maven mvn -Dmaven.test.skip=true -U clean install mvn clean package -U (强制拉一次) mvn archetype:create-from-pro…
Maven profile整合Spring profile
在Maven和Spring中,都有profile这个概念。profile是用于区分各种环境的,例如开发环境、测试环境、正式环境等。Maven的profile用于在打包时根据指定环境替换不同环境的配置文件配置,如数据库配置…
在使用spring-boot-maven-plugin的下生成普通的jar包
当使用springboot的maven插件的时候,默认是生成的可执行jar包,如果我们想让其生成普通的jar包该怎么做呢? 一、解决办法 直接上方法 mvn clean package -D spring-boot.re…
Fundebug后端Java异常监控插件更新至0.3.1,修复Maven下载失败的问题
摘要: 0.3.1修复Maven下载失败的问题。 监控Java应用 1. pom.xml 配置fundebug-java依赖 <dependency> <groupId>com.fundebug&…
gradle-学习笔记(2)-多项目构建
记得在maven中支持多个子项目的构建方法,同样的在gradle 中也会支持多项目的构建方法 还记得在maven中如何配置多项目工程吗, 这里回忆一下 首先我们需要一个父元素pom文件比如这样 <?xml vers…
Maven 国内源配置(2019/2/14)
新年开工后要开始新的项目,但是发现一些项目的依赖没有在阿里仓库Central或Public源之中,项目依赖还是要在外网中下载,很慢、很烦······ 所以一番查找后,替换为阿里官方仓库服务站点: https://mave…
maven项目在svn中的上传与检出
前言 企业开发中经常使用svn来为我们控制代码版本,也经常使用maven来管理项目。下面将介绍一下如何将maven项目上传到svn中,如何将项目从svn中检出。 上传到svn maven项目上传与普通项目上传并无区别。这…
J2EE开发笔记(一)—— J2EE开发环境配置
最近电脑重新装了系统,所有J2EE相关软件都需要重新安装配置,现将其中部分软件安装配置过程记录如下,方便参考查阅。 tips:所有软件均可在官网免费下载,尽量不要使用第三方提供的软件包。 Java开发环境配置 JDK安装…
使用Gradle发布构件(Jar)到Maven中央仓库
OSSRH 在开始之前,先对 OSSRH做下了解是很必要的,因为一开始,我并不知道这是个啥玩儿意。我想和我一样的人应该还是有很多的。 OSSRH:Sonatype Open Source Software Reposit…
Maven配置覆盖内嵌tomcat虚拟映射路径
Maven配置覆盖内嵌tomcat虚拟映射路径 直接配置报错,错误提示如下: Caused by: java.lang.IllegalArgumentException: addChild: Child name '/s…